Dr. Jason Fung, MD, is one of the leading voices challenging everything diet culture has taught women about food, weight, and willpower. If you've ever blamed yourself for not having enough discipline around food, this episode is for you.

In this conversation, Dr. Jason Fung sits down with Tamsen Fadal to debunk the "calories in, calories out" myth and reveal how hormones, ultra-processed foods, and different types of hunger play a much bigger role than we've been led to believe.He explains the three types of hunger, why you’re not losing weight, and what’s actually happening to women’s bodies during perimenopause. He also talks about insulin, fasting, and mindset shifts that will make you healthier, happier, and more energized.

Tamsen and Dr. Fung discuss:

  • The three types of hunger: homeostatic, hedonic, and conditioned
  • Why ultra-processed foods lead to cravings and overeating
  • Insulin, fat storage, and energy crashes after eating
  • Perimenopause, menopause, and belly fat: what your hormones are really doing
  • Practical ways to reduce “food noise” and mindless eating
  • Intermittent fasting for women
  • Why women gain weight without changing their habits
